Pharmaceutical Technical Assistants (PTAs) work under the supervision of a pharmacist to dispense medication, prepare ointments and other prescriptions, and test drugs and chemicals in the pharmacy laboratory for quality.

This job is characterized by personal interactions with customers, providing advice and health education to patients, and requires a strong knowledge base, a sense of responsibility, and a passion for working with people.


The 2.5-year training program consists of two years of theoretical and practical classroom instruction, followed by a six-month internship in a pharmacy.

With the growing awareness of health in our society, the role of a PTA is becoming increasingly important.


To be eligible for the training program, applicants must have a high school diploma with an average grade of 3.5 or higher.


The professional learning area includes:

  • Dispensing prescriptions
  • Providing advice and over-the-counter medication
  • Offering and providing services
  • Participating in business development and management
  • Quality control
  • Preparing medications
The cross-professional learning area includes: * German/communication * English/communication

Workplaces for PTAs include:

  • Public and hospital pharmacies
  • Pharmaceutical and chemical companies
  • Pharmaceutical or cosmetic industry
  • Health insurance companies
  • Pharmaceutical representatives
  • Universities/PTA schools
The training program begins annually in September.
